In May 2026, we will launch TEP@Curaçao: an intensive week of research that brings together theater, education, and cultural entrepreneurship. The Theatre Education Platform (TEP) brings together creators, educators, schools, policymakers, and international partners to address one pressing question: How can we build a sustainable future for theater education and the cultural sector in the Caribbean and Suriname?
The context of Curaçao is at the heart of this week. Drawing on the rich local traditions of storytelling, music, and community art, we are developing new forms of education and collaboration. In a multilingual society, where people switch between languages and worlds on a daily basis, theater offers a unique space for expression, identity formation, and connection. At the same time, the need is urgent: there is a chronic shortage of trained theater teachers and a fragile cultural production chain in which talent does not always have the opportunity to flourish.
During this research week, we will not only talk, but above all, take action. In practical workshops, theater professionals, teachers, and young people work together to develop new forms of theater education rooted in the Curaçaoan context. At the same time, creators and producers are developing concrete plans for cultural productions—from concept to presentation—through an intensive process. Co-creation, learning by doing, and connecting local knowledge with international expertise are central to our approach.
This week is more than just a snapshot; it is a building block for a broader movement. The proceeds will serve as the foundation for a regional, accelerated associate degree program in Theater Education and for a stronger, more sustainable cultural ecosystem in which education, creators, and policy reinforce one another.
